Development Pipeline definition

Development Pipeline has the meaning set forth in Section 7.3(c).
Development Pipeline means approved, not sunsetted, and unbuilt lots for which there is an entitlement and expectation of use of the City of Brandon wastewater and/or water capacity for development projects of any type that are approved and under construction and bound by a Development Agreement;
Development Pipeline means all Projects where Developer is solely or jointly responsible for obtaining or providing equity financing, except any Project which pursuant to Section 2.2 is not subject to Section 2.1. ​ ​
